Roles and Responsibilities:

  • Taking care of customer's telephone call.
  • Assisted advertisement coordinator with planning and executing corporate promotion and sponsorship events.
  • Customize layout for advertisement.
  • Develop and design all aspects of weekly ad circular.
  • Responsible and reviewed all ad insertions.
  • Responsible for all television ads negotiation duties within all markets.
  • Communicate and manage all flow with department managers to gather merchandise for each ad.
  • Responsible for all newspaper, radio related all advertising media.
  • Recruit, conduct, and document new ad. agent orientations.
  • Responsible for service to customers over the telephone and meet daily and weekly advertisement.
  • Managed ad circular and in-store signage programs for store grocery retail division.
  • Responsible for all advertisement newspaper, radio, and television negotiation duties within all markets of the division.
